In actuality, it\u2019s a supply line to U.S. Gulf Coast refineries, which have a contract for up to a 20-year binding commercial agreement to receive oil through the XL pipeline and refine it into\u00a0gasoline, aviation fuels, and diesel fuels for U.S. consumption.<\/p>\n<p>Yes, U.S. refiners have been refining and exporting heavy Canadian crude, a cheaper grade than West Texas Intermediate. But given the current market condition and transportation costs, exporting is now less economically viable.<\/p>\n<p>The fact is, the United States will still need to import oil to meet its domestic demand for decades to come, despite its growing oil production. Using oil from Canada will displace more expensive heavy crude oils coming from less stable countries, such as Venezuela and Mexico.<\/p>\n<p>And let\u2019s face it \u2013 most of us would prefer sourcing oil from a friendly neighbor than, say, Saudi Arabia.<\/p>\n<p>In addition to transporting crude from Canada, the pipeline will also support the growth of crude production in the United States by allowing American oil producers greater access to the large refining markets in the Midwest and Gulf Coast.<\/p>\n<p>The Keystone XL project is also expected to contribute roughly $3.4 billion to the economy.<\/p>\n<p>In addition to the 42,100 direct and indirect jobs it will create during its two-year construction, the XL pipeline has already supported more than 7,000 jobs through the billions spent on sourcing U.S. goods and services.<\/p>\n<p>And while many argue that the boon to employment is only temporary and jobs will terminate post-construction, pipelines <em>do<\/em> require ongoing operations, service, maintenance, and repair.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cBut what about those destructive environmental and health impacts?\u201d you might ask\u2026<\/p>\n<h2>Time to Pull the Wool OFF Your Eyes<\/h2>\n<p>The reality is, the pipeline won\u2019t cross any reservation lands or lands held in a trust. TransCanada has even proposed working with tribes over the project\u2019s\u00a0lifecycle and proactively addressing any concerns, while striving to create employment opportunities for tribe communities along\u00a0the route.<\/p>\n<p>TransCanada has also built wind farms, solar facilities, and hydro operations in an effort to offset the emission produced during their operations. In fact, the Carbon Disclosure Project ranked TransCanada as an A-list company for making legitimate steps towards climate change mitigation in 2014.<\/p>\n<p>But of course the biggest pet peeve among the anti-XL\u2019ers is that the pipeline would carry some of the dirtiest and most polluting oil in the world.<\/p>\n<p>Arguments range from the oil\u2019s effect on the Great Plains Aquifer under southern Nebraska to the fate of the American burying beetle, one of the 14 species that could be affected by the pipeline\u2019s construction.<\/p>\n<p>Opponents also say all that extra fossil fuel will exacerbate global warming because Canadian oil sands crude creates 17% more greenhouse gas emissions than the oil produced in the United States.<\/p>\n<p>Yes, Alberta\u2019s oil sands are more viscous and contain more impurities than other types of oil, but it will get to its destination in one form or another.
